Understanding the Time Delay Feature in LG Washing Machine
The time delay feature in LG washing machines is designed to provide users with the flexibility to postpone the start of their wash cycle to a later time. This feature comes in handy for various reasons, such as wanting the laundry to finish at a specific time, making use of off-peak electricity hours, or ensuring that the laundry is ready when you return home. By setting the time delay, you can plan your laundry routine according to your convenience and make the best use of your LG washing machine.
Step-by-Step Guide: How to Set Time Delay in LG Washing Machine
Step 1: Power On the Washing Machine Start by pressing the power button on your LG washing machine to turn it on. Wait for the control panel to illuminate, indicating that the machine is ready for operation.
Step 2: Select the Wash Cycle Next, select the desired wash cycle by turning the cycle selector knob or pressing the corresponding button on the control panel. Choose the appropriate wash program based on your laundry needs, such as normal, delicate, heavy-duty, or quick wash.
Step 3: Adjust Additional Settings (If Required) Depending on the model of your LG washing machine, you may have additional settings to choose from, such as temperature, spin speed, and rinse options. Adjust these settings according to your preferences for the specific wash cycle.
Step 4: Access the Time Delay Function Look for the “Time Delay” button on the control panel. It is usually labeled with a clock icon or the text “Time Delay” next to it. Press this button to access the time delay function.
Step 5: Set the Delay Time Once you have accessed the time delay function, use the +/- buttons or the dial to set the desired delay time. You can typically set the delay in hours, ranging from a few hours up to 24 hours, depending on the model.
Step 6: Confirm the Time Delay After setting the desired delay time, press the “Start” or “Delay Start” button to confirm the time delay. The control panel may display a message or indicator light to show that the time delay has been successfully set.
Step 7: Start the Time Delayed Wash Cycle Once the time delay is set and confirmed, press the start button to initiate the time-delayed wash cycle. The washing machine will automatically start the selected wash program after the set delay time has elapsed.
Tips for Using the Time Delay Feature Effectively
- Plan According to Your Schedule: Use the time delay feature to schedule your laundry cycle at a time that aligns with your daily routine, such as when you return from work or during off-peak electricity hours.
- Avoid Prolonged Delay Times: While you can set a time delay of up to 24 hours, it’s best to avoid prolonged delays to prevent clothes from sitting in the washing machine for an extended period.
- Use Energy-Efficient Modes: Consider using energy-efficient wash modes and setting a time delay to utilize off-peak electricity hours, saving on energy costs.
- Ensure Proper Load Size: Before setting the time delay, ensure that you have properly loaded the washing machine with the appropriate amount of laundry. Overloading or underloading may affect washing performance.
- Refer to the User Manual: For specific instructions and model-specific features, refer to the user manual provided by LG.

FAQs
1. Can I Cancel the Time Delay Once It’s Set? Yes, you can cancel the time delay by pressing the cancel or reset button before the start of the delayed wash cycle.
2. Can I Change the Delay Time Once It’s Set? Yes, you can change the delay time before starting the delayed wash cycle. Access the time delay function and adjust the delay time accordingly.
3. Can I Use the Time Delay for Any Wash Cycle? Yes, you can use the time delay feature for most wash cycles available on your LG washing machine. However, certain specialized cycles may not have this option.
4. Will the Washing Machine Turn On Automatically After the Delay Time? Yes, once the set delay time elapses, the washing machine will automatically start the selected wash cycle.
5. Can I Use the Time Delay for Multiple Wash Cycles in Advance? This capability may vary depending on the model of your LG washing machine. Some models may allow you to set a time delay for multiple cycles in advance, while others may require you to set it for each cycle individually. Refer to the user manual for model-specific information.
6. Is There a Limit to the Time Delay Duration? The time delay duration varies depending on the model of your LG washing machine. Most models offer a time delay of up to 24 hours.
7. Can I Use the Time Delay for All Wash Programs? In most LG washing machines, you can use the time delay feature for a wide range of wash programs, including normal, delicate, heavy-duty, and more.
8. Is the Time Delay Feature Energy-Efficient? Yes, using the time delay feature along with off-peak electricity hours can be energy-efficient, as it allows you to take advantage of lower electricity rates.
